Example #1
0
 public override void Tick()
 {
     this.ageTicks++;
     if (this.Severity >= 1f)
     {
         Hediff_Fractal.DoMutation(this.pawn);
         this.pawn.Destroy();
     }
 }
Example #2
0
 // Token: 0x06004362 RID: 17250 RVA: 0x001E7FF8 File Offset: 0x001E63F8
 public override void Tick()
 {
     this.ageTicks++;
     if (this.Severity >= 1f)
     {
         if (this.Visible && PawnUtility.ShouldSendNotificationAbout(this.pawn))
         {
             Messages.Message("ColonistMutated".Translate(new object[]
             {
                 this.pawn.LabelIndefinite()
             }).CapitalizeFirst(), this.pawn, MessageTypeDefOf.ThreatBig);
         }
         Hediff_Fractal.DoMutation(this.pawn);
         this.pawn.Destroy();
     }
 }